Originally Posted by Birdog3
IM running 37's with5:13s and a 6 speed and im turning almost 3000 rpm at 65mph so you have to be doing more than that!
You have a Manual, he has an Auto. There is just about zero similarity between them.

With 5.13's and 33's (appx 32" actual height), he'll be running about 2600 rpm at 70. A 6spd with 5.13's would need to be rolling on 40's (39" actual height) to run the same rpm.

Originally Posted by DCJEEP
Looks like plans have changed. Might be running the 33's for a while. Anyone run that setup?
Faq's --> rpm chart !!
As well as several similar threads in just the last 2 days. You have an Auto. You'll be fine. Roughly 2600 rpm at 70 mph. Same as a bone stock 6spd rubicon driving right out of the factory doors.

The only negative will be if you tow heavy loads with OD Off. OD On, you will love it.
